Bruno Rodzik (29 May 1935 – 12 April 1998) was a French former football defender. He played for France in the Euro 1960.
International career
Rodzik was born in France, and was of Polish descent. He was an international footballer for the France national football team.[1]
Titles
- French championship in 1958, 1960, 1962 with Stade de Reims
- European Cup runner-up in 1959 with Stade de Reims
